Introduction To Neuroimaging Methods

Lent Term 2021

We are offering introductory lectures on neuroimaging data analysis as well as brain stimulation in January/February 2021. These events will happen online on Mondays (am and pm) and on Tuesdays (am), and will take 1-2 hours. They are free and open to researchers from Cambridge (from cam.ac.uk domain). Details will be announced before individual events via our skillstraining mailing list. To subscribe, please send an e-mail to skillstraining-subscribe@mrc-cbu.cam.ac.uk .

Our workshops are targeted at master’s/PhD students and post-doctoral researchers from the Cambridge cognitive neuroscience community. Look here for other training opportunities in and around Cambridge.
